Predict the Oscars Contest - Final Results!

The 82nd Academy Awards have come and gone, meaning it is time to announce the winner of our Predict the Oscars fundraising contest!

It was a Hurt Locker kind of night...

The Predict the Oscars contest was a fundraising contest to benefit Relentless Optimism, our team for the Susan G. Komen 3 Day for the Cure.  We asked everyone to guess who they thought would win the Oscars in all 24 categories.  Each entry was accompanied by a $10 to our team.  Half of the money collected is awarded to the person that correctly predicts the winner in the most categories with the other half of the money going towards our fundraising efforts.  Altogether, we had 18 completed entries for this contest and successfully raised $90 for Relentless Optimism!

In general, our entrants did much better at predicting the outcome of the Oscars than they did back in January for the Golden Globes, with 11 of you correctly predicting the winner in more than half the categories.  Our winner, Paul Jarnagin, did an outstanding job, correctly predicting the winner in 18 of the 24 categories.  The only categories that Paul missed were Adapted Screenplay (a tricky one all the way around), Sound Editing, Cinematography, Animated and Live Action Short and Foreign Language Film.  All in all, Paul did a great job and will be taking home the $90 cash prize.  Congratulations Paul!
